i am going to get some baby chick. i live in indiana. what breeds are going to give me the most eggs for the least amout of feed?
 
Leghorns, Andalusians or Minorcas are a good choice. They're very flighty if not handled so they can get away from a predator quick (a good thing if you want to free range). They are lanky and don't eat as much as bigger breeds, which you want. And they'll enjoy eating greens if they free range, and the won't need to eat as much food.
